5.3 Configuring Access Control Metadata
You must first provide the user with access privileges, so the user can perform activities throughout various functional areas in Behavior Detection. This enables the user to access at least one of each of the following:
- Jurisdiction: Scope of activity monitoring for example, Geographical Jurisdiction or Legal entity.
- Business Domain: Operational line of business.
- Role: Permissions or authorizations assigned to a user.
Clients can change or add new values for these data types like jurisdiction, business domain (with the exception of User Role) based on specific requirements. The following section explains how to add or modify these data types.
